About VSE Corporation Tangible Equity
IPO dateFeb 5, 2026
Employees1600

VSE Corp is a diversified aftermarket products and services company serving commercial and government markets. The Company's operations include aircraft and airframe parts supply and distribution, and MRO services of aircraft components and engine accessories.
